Distracted driving

Every driver is responsible to drive safely and be aware of the road. Distracted driving is the leading cause of collisions and near-collisions and is extremely dangerous for other drivers on the road. If you've been injured by a distracted driver you could be legally entitled to compensation.

Although many people think of texting or calling when they hear the term distracted driving It's actually any other activity that takes your hands off of the steering wheel, your eyes off the road, or takes your mind away from the task at the present moment. This includes eating, reaching into the car for items as well as interacting with other passengers and adjusting the controls on the dashboard like the radio or temperature. It can also be personal grooming, like shaving or applying makeup.

According to research by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) and the Virginia Tech Transportation Institute (VTTI) approximately 80 percent all crashes and 65 per cent of near-collisions are the result of distracted driving. Even taking your eyes off of the road for five seconds at 55 mph doubles the risk of a crash.

Uninsured or underinsured drivers

Some drivers don't have insurance and Auto Accident Attorneys others only have a minimal amount of insurance. It can be difficult to recover the compensation you are due if an uninsured motorist causes a crash. In these instances you must have a skilled legal advocate to assist you in meeting your objectives as well as those of the insurer.

When the other driver's liability limits aren't high enough to pay for your losses, you may be able to file a claim under your own insurance policy's underinsured/uninsured motorist coverage. This type of insurance is usually part of an insurance policy that covers all of your needs, and it could provide you with crucial protections in the event of a serious accident.

The process for filing UIM/UM claims is similar the usual auto accident claim. It usually involves submitting copies of your medical bills as well as auto repair bills. The insurance company will look over these documents and other documents to determine if your losses are covered under the other driver's policy.

The law in New York is based on comparative negligence. This means that if you're held partially accountable for an accident, you'll have your damages reduced by the amount of blame you're given. The defendant could also find themselves to be the sole responsible for the incident and thus ineligible to recover at all.

Be careful not to give any written or oral statements to representatives from the at-fault parties' insurance companies, since these could be later used against you in court. It is also recommended to see your doctor as soon as possible following the accident. Some injuries can take a while to manifest and may be used against you in court if later you attempt to claim compensation.
